Closed petition Amend rules on indoor sports to allow players who turn 18 to finish the season
Closed on
Under the current rule of 6, U18 Club players of indoor sports are excluded from participating in youth leagues, immediately upon turning 18 yrs old. We want the Government to amend this ruling to allow these players to complete the season with their Club, as was previously the rule prior to Covid.
The 'rule of six' puts the future stability of sport under threat, with clubs unable to field an U18 team throughout the season. Without a change to this ruling, club sport for U18s will be decimated. Incredibly the same group can compete within school sport throughout the year, yet barred from competing at the weekend for club. This anomaly exacerbates the frustrations faced by this age group and undermines their mental health. It must be corrected for basketball, netball, volleyball and many other indoor sports.
